Runbook: Glyphden wiki role-based access rollout

Before promoting a release, verify the role matrix: viewers must not see draft spaces, editors must not alter space-level permissions, and admin grants require two approvers. Run the permission smoke suite against staging with all three synthetic accounts, and confirm audit log entries appear for each denied action. Release manager sign-off is conditional on a clean run. Record your verification against the build identified below.

pipeline stamp: htk31_f769b577b3028a4e9958e5bb8d1259a

Handover Note — Retirement of the Orvan Line

To my successor: the decision to retire the Orvan product line was taken last quarter after two years of declining margins and rising warranty claims from the Kestwick plant. Remaining inventory should clear by March; service obligations run a further eighteen months. Please keep the support team intact until then, and watch the parts supplier contract, which auto-renews. The commercial reasoning, including what replaces Orvan, is set out in the confidential note below.

confidential, kagap-yagef: The finance team signed off on a budget of $467.8 million for Project Aldok.

The Lanternfall rollout framework gates every plugin behind a staged flag: internal, canary, then general availability. Plugin authors should never hardcode flag states; query the Lanternfall API at startup and subscribe to change events so rollbacks propagate within seconds. Your plugin authenticates to that API with a per-author credential issued during registration, and the next line sets it.

vault entry, kafog-yahop: COURIER_KEY8=0faa53ae

Modelled returns clear our hurdle rate under base and downside cases, though working-capital commitments in year one are heavier than first indicated. Governance terms remain unresolved, particularly board composition and exit mechanics. Treasury confirms funding capacity without new debt. Legal review continues in parallel. Our recommended negotiating position is recorded confidentially below.

confidential, kagup-bafog: Fraaxax Group is in early talks to buy Soroxox Group for about $343.8 million. The Olidor launch date is June 14, and nothing goes to the press before then. Legal wants the Aldmirek Logistics term sheet signed before July 23.